The city of Greenholden. The shining beacon on the Northern coast of Rhomas. To this day it has been a bright light that shines for everyone to follow its example. Now, it doesn't mean it doesn't have its fair share of issues. There are many a thieves' guild, nobles wanting to get the one-up on each other, and crazy megalomaniacs attempting to take over the world, but for now it is generally kept to a minimum thanks to the amazing adventurers' guild The Seven Saints. People of all ages, backgrounds, and professions have requested to join the Seven Saints due to their reputation as benevolent and caring people, as well as giving free dental. However, adventuring is not for the faint of heart. Those who apply must go through arduous testing and training, having to go through obstacle courses, combat rounds, battles of wits, and a spelling bee. Thankfully you have done well in your own personal field, showing your courage and ability to adapt to the situation, and have received a letter that reads as follows.
"Congratulations, lucky adventurer! You have been accepted into the Greenholden branch of The Seven Saints Adventuring Company. Within this envelope you will find directions to the adventurer's dormatory, a signet ring that shows your membership into The Seven Saints, and five coupons for the first ale or wine at 50% off at the local tavern, The Sister's Sonata. Please attend the induction ceremony for you and your future adventuring companions that will be happening tomorrow afternoon. Yours faithfully, Saint Jeremiah l'Corran, Guildmaster."
Within the letter is a bronze coloured ring, fitted to your finger size for your convenience, as well as several water-resistant slips of parchment for the aforementioned discounts. It appears that only one coupon can be used per visit.
The directions given lead to the guildhall of The Seven Saints. Within the industrial ward of Greenholden, there are many magnificent towers that seemingly reach the sky with their ornate spires and intresting statues of various heroes throughout the ages. The guildhall itself is atop one of these huge buildings. Using the convenient transport in this megacity, magical tiles that propel oneself from the ground to a platform or connecting bridge higher up the buildings, you find yourselves landing in a large colourful garden with long flower beds of roses, bluebells, and other colourful hues. Beyond the flower garden is a huge marble building with shining glass windows. The emblem of The Seven Saints, a circle with seven four-pointed stars evenly spread around the circle's edge, is crafted above the guildhall entrance is a shining silver metal.
It seems you are not alone in joining up here in the start as a brand new Saint adventurer.

A short, thin man with shaggy black hair steps off one of the tiles and looks around. He seems to be wearing brand new clothing for the occasion, but seems uncomfortable doing so. Around his neck is what seems to be a rather large uncut black crystal. He walks up to the other hires and says, "Hello! My name's Johann, nice to meet you all. Are all of you new adventurers too?"
Johann can see that there is a large number of people arriving (not just the party, but several dozen others as well). From some goblins rushing forward with some colourful clothing to an enormous goliath striding over to the place, clad in just hunting furs.

Well, you just got fired from your job recently, got your partner killed, and pretty much alienated everyone you know. You can't even go back to your home city. Now you're out on your own, fending for yourself. Lets try and not mess THIS up, OK? She thought to herself. Crispy wasn't smiling. She usually never did. Especially not lately. Not after so much garbage in her life had just been piled on to her. It wasn't just the garbage of her past, but now of her present. The demons inside were the worst, but this new city had promise, and she had no one to fall back on anymore. It was time to make a new start. One that, hopefully, didn't involve bribing, extorting, bullying, and acting above the law. Well, maybe a little bit.
Crispy was a beautiful woman. Bright blue eyes that hid the hurt and pain inside, and a lean, curvy physique that anyone would envy. Born of violence and raised in the military, it was clear she could handle herself in a fight, and had spent years training her body to be a precision weapon. She was tan, and her shoulder length brown hair was tied in a ponytail On her right hip were a pair of military grade short swords, right in reach. Her outfit of choice was tight studded leathers that hugged all of her curves, with her long jacket that came to her knees.
"Hey Johann." Crispy nods, professionally to the short thin man addressing her. "I'm Crispy. I'm assuming this is the place?"
Entering the main building, where the others are congregating, there is a large foyer that is well illuminated by globes of light hovering overhead as well as the large stained glass allowing in the bright sunlight. People seem to be wandering into small groups, chatting to one another and getting introductions out of the way. Ahead seems to be a large alabaster desk with five humans, three female and two male, wearing blue gowns with the Seven Saints emblems embroidered on their front standing on the other side, apparently taking people's names for attendance.
A tiny, old halfling grins broadly, his eyes shrinking to slits as he approaches Johann. He bows deeply, reducing his three feet to half that and then stands erect again, looking up at the black-haired man. "I am Akaas, also a new adventurer with the Seven Saints." The old monk is bald on top, but sports an impressive amount of white hair that grows from the base of his skull, above his eyes, on his upper lip, and out of his chin. In fact, his beard touched the floor during his bow. He's wearing beautiful blue robes decorated with silver lettering in vertical stripes. (Anyone who speaks Celestial would recognize the script.) On the left chest of his robe is a silver brooch upon which is embossed a pair of eyes surrounded by seven stars — the symbol of Selune. Akaas looks around the garden and then back up at Johann. "Have you lived in Greenholden long? I have just recently relocated here from the Monastery of the White Lady in Adonaselune." A man walks to the halfling's side, "Excuse me sir.". At a glance you can notice the man's cropped and kept black hair, similar to ones at cloisters of priests, and his robes that cover the leather armor he wears. A brooch kept at the base of his hood bared the symbol of a platinum dragon. His eyes looked to the stripes on the Akaas' robes, as if reading them. He notices he has been staring for a bit too long and blushes, "I'm sorry, sir. I was just interested in your robes, quite beautiful. Are you a devout to the goddess Selune? I, myself, am an acolyte to Bahamut.". He bows to you and regards you with soft purple eyes, "I am Chetin, Chetin Humb, I hope to keep you all healthy and alive during our travels."
Akaas turns his broad smile on Chetin and bows again. "Yes, my son. I have been blessed to be one of Our Lady's children for close to a century and a half. I entered the monastery in Adonaselune at a very young age and lived there until very recently. It was only a couple weeks ago that I took my leave and decided to seek the White Lady's favor as an adventurer. I admit that I was unprepared for how different Greenholden would be from my home," he says congenially, motioning to the extravagance around them. "I have done a little study on the subject of the platinum dragon. It's a very honorable religion."
Chetin nods, "I find it enlightening. Although I would love to hear of your Lady as well, I studied a bit about her but only know little of the goddess. I'd happily share what I can tell you of my lord, Bahamut.". And he laughs slightly, "And yes, Greenholden is quite a big city, I'm thankful that I've found some kindred souls to help me settle here." He bows his head, "Now if you'll excuse me, I believe we must take an attendance of sorts with the Company's staff. Hopefully we shall meet again, sir Akaas." He walks off, his mace by his side bouncing with him and a glimmering shield on his back.
Well Kithre, you made it lass. Through trials and tribulations, you're here. Elucard would be so proud of you, try not to embarrass him through your actions.Kithre thinks to herself as she trails behind the mass of people heading into the main building. Her leather armor hasn't seen much wear, and features a swirling motif all over the place. She has a floppy-brimmed hat, but it's currently rolled up and tucked into a large epaulet on her left shoulder. A backpack sits over her shoulders with a gorgeous looking lute strapped to the side, while a flute sits in a leather holster on her hip, just in front of a rapier. Seeing the others are talking among themselves draws a smile from the young halfling. Brushing her coppery-blonde hair back over her ears, she walks up to one of the Seven Saints desk attendants.
"Hello there! I'm Kithre Cherrycheeks, I was told to attend today's event." she says, voice full of an excitement and cheer that carries through to her sparkling pale green eyes. "I've a paper here somewhere to that effect."she says, starting to pat down her various pockets and pouches looking for the letter.
Those who have entered also note that others are wearing bronze rings similar to their own. They then see walking into the main foyer is a golden-skinned aasimar with long flowing hair. She is wearing shiny adamantine plate armour and has a silver ring with the same effect on it. She seems to be busy as she just walks through, not stopping to talk to anyone before walking up a flight of stairs and leaving out of view.
After being ignored by Chetin, Johann turns back to Crispy and Akaas and says, "Nice to meet you both! I do think this is the place, Crispy. By the way, Crispy, this is Akaas from the Monastery of the White Lady in Adonaselune. I hope that we can all get along well in our time here. Shall we also go to get checked in? Akaas, I'm not very strong, but if you need any help getting there, I'd gladly help." Johann gestures to the desk, where everyone seems to be congregating.
A Female half-orc walks up to the opening, she looks around the outside before moving inwards, she has a tankard of ale in her right hand, taking sips from it occasionally. She stands around 6'3" her hair is platted into a ponytail, her light green skin is mostly covered with chain mail, she has a cloak and a shield with a pattern on it depicting a pair of large silver fangs. She moves in and heads to the desk where everyone else is.

Headed towards the desk, the group can see one of the people one the other side of the table is free to speak to. She looks up to the group. "Good morning, adventurers. I assume you are here for induction." She says, looking at the bronze rings each of you has been supplied with. "Well if you can tell me your names I'll have you signed in for the induction."
Akaas inclines his head toward Johann. "I appreciate the gesture, young man" he says kindly, "but I require no assistance." He turns to approach the desk, no hint of physical deficiency in his gate. When it comes his turn, he bows slightly to the desk attendant. "Master Akaas Fordus of the Order of the Moon Soul," he says politely, "new and eager recruit to the Seven Saints Adventuring Company. I am very pleased to be here."
The attendant at the desk seems to look through a rafter of parchment. She seems to stop a couple of pages down. "Ah, here we are. Akaas Fordus. We'll make note of your attendance, you and your future comrades will be headed through for induction shortly."
Johann follows Akaas to the desk with a nod to Crispy. He waits for his turn, then says, "Nice to meet you. My name is Johann Glorypunch, also here for the induction."
A man bursts through the door, panting in a full set of plate armor he removes his helmet. His armor looks worn, covered in scratches. The man stands at around 6 feet, a giant blade headed glaive sits on his back. Around his neck is a holy symbol representing a road leading to the sun. His face looks about as well as the armor does, covered in old scars that lay on his face along side his blue eyes and short black hair. “Sorry I‘m late” the voice comes out in a simple manner, speaking with both respect and authority
